Great build! I have a 2010 OB and looking at the same with my bumpers. How did you end up protecting the windshield washer reservoir?
Thanks Cyrull! Sorry it has taken so long to respond here. As you can see in post #16, in the photo labeled Sub 7, there are tapered skirts that start small in the front and taper wide towards the ends of the bumper. The widest section of the skirt comes down enough to tuck under the windshield washer reservoir. Best of luck on your build!

Would you recommend the excel Gs?
I've got to change my shocks and I'm feeling sticker shock looking at most of the outback options.
Hey there, also sorry for the delayed response. I would recommend the excel Gs. KYB makes great upgraded shocks for Subarus. Along with the excel Gs I also put in slightly stiffer RalliTEK springs. Depending on what you want to do, they have a lot of options for outbacks. Best of luck.
